The Technical Foundations of Secure Transactions
At its core, banking security in online casinos relies on a combination of encryption protocols and cybersecurity measures. The most common encryption standard is SSL (Secure Socket Layer), which ensures that data transferred between players and casinos is secure. Here’s how it works:
- Data Encryption: SSL encrypts data using a unique key, making it unreadable to unauthorized users.
- Authentication: SSL certificates verify that the casino is a legitimate entity.
- Data Integrity: SSL ensures that the data sent and received is not altered during transmission.
These technical measures are essential to maintain player trust and protect sensitive information like bank details and personal identification.

Regulatory Framework and Its Role in Security
The regulatory landscape for online casinos plays a pivotal role in ensuring banking security. Reputable jurisdictions, such as Malta and the UK, have stringent regulations that require casinos to implement robust security measures. For instance, casinos licensed in the UK must adhere to the Gambling Commission’s guidelines, which mandate:
- Regular audits of financial transactions.
- Implementation of anti-money laundering (AML) policies.
- Protection of consumer data through advanced cybersecurity protocols.
These regulations not only protect players but also enhance the credibility of the online gambling industry.
Hidden Risks: Phishing and Social Engineering Threats
While secure banking systems offer a robust defense, players must also be aware of hidden risks such as phishing and social engineering attacks. In 2022, approximately 30% of online gamblers reported encountering phishing attempts aimed at stealing their login credentials or financial information. Here’s how these attacks typically manifest:
- Phishing Emails: Fraudulent emails that appear to be from legitimate casinos, asking for sensitive information.
- Fake Websites: Clones of real casino sites designed to capture player data.
- Social Engineering: Manipulative tactics used to trick players into revealing personal information.
Awareness and education are crucial for players to navigate these threats effectively.

Future Trends in Online Casino Banking Security
The landscape of banking security in online casinos is continually evolving. Emerging technologies, such as blockchain and artificial intelligence, are set to play significant roles in enhancing security measures:
- Blockchain Technology: Offers unprecedented transparency and security in transactions.
- AI Fraud Detection: Machine learning algorithms can identify unusual patterns of behavior that may indicate fraudulent activity.
As these technologies mature, they could redefine the standards for security in online gambling, providing players with peace of mind.
